How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 89506?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
89506 Studio Apartments | $1,658 | $895 | $2,694 |
89506 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,603 | $561 | $3,835 |
89506 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,735 | $878 | $4,684 |
89506 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,749 | $822 | $4,369 |
89506 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,468 | $667 | $3,409 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 89506 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 89506?
There are currently 33 Studio Apartments in 89506 with rent ranges from $773 to $2,694 with an average price of $1,658.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 89506 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 89506 ranges from $561 to $3,835 with an average monthly rent of $1,603.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 89506 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 89506 range from $878 to $4,684.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,735.
How expensive are 89506 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 34 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 89506 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$822 to $4,369 - averaging $1,749 for the location.
